Fall / Papillon / 1977
CHAMPION FIRCREST FANTUTTE Standing on the podium at the Papillon Club of Scotland Championship Show where she won the Best in Show. Owners: Mr & Mrs Hutchings Date: 1977

The Papillon breed, also known as the Contin continental Toy Spaniel, is a small, elegant dog breed with a distinctive butterfly-like ear shape. Originating in Europe, Papillons have been beloved companions for centuries, prized for their playful personalities and distinctive appearance.
